WitrynaThe Family and Medical Leave Act (FMLA) is a United States labor law that provides eligible employees with unpaid job-protected leave for specified family and medical reasons. The act was signed into law by President Bill Clinton on February 5, 1993, and it has since been amended several times. WitrynaThe FMLA only requires unpaid leave. However, the law permits an employee to elect, or the employer to require the employee, to use accrued paid vacation leave, paid sick or family leave for some or all of the FMLA leave period. Witryna10Q: Would the common flu or a severe cold be covered under the FMLA when an employee is out for more than three days? A: Typically, such transient illnesses are not considered a serious health condition and would not, therefore, be covered under FMLA. We urge you to be careful with these types of considerations.
